Abstract
The utility model discloses an intelligent key management box system, it is wholly formed by the secret cabinet transformation of ordinary digital password, including intelligent key case box, main control chip, fingerprint identification module, the motor lock, wifi module and key state detect the matrix, the nimble perfect thing networking function of hardware platform is believed a little in its utilization, the convenient and fast who combines public's platform, the problem of be hard to track and the management because key and user are numerous before is solved, the personnel that borrow retrieve from the key, the key predetermined to the key track with urge still can be all completion on believing the public number a little, it all is a APP's thing networking theory to have accorded with each hardware, the efficiency of work and management is improved, fingerprint identification module's joining simultaneously make the person of borroing borrow only need easily press when going back the key finger alright open the door, extremely convenient, and the security is high.

Detailed description of the invention
With the following Examples this utility model is further described.
Intelligent key management box system as shown in Figure 1-2, its entirety is formed, including intelligence by the transformation of ordinary numbers password protecting cabinet
Energy key locker casing 12, main control chip 1, fingerprint identification module 2, electromechanical locks 3, wifi module 4 and key status detection square
Battle array 5.Fingerprint identification module 2, wifi module 4, electromechanical locks 3 are connected with main control chip 1 respectively with key status detection matrix 5,
RTC clock module 7 and EEPROM storage chip 8 (i.e. EEPROM it is also associated with on main control chip 1
The storage chip that after a kind of power down, data are not lost).
In the market Fingerprint Lock in order to pursue cheap, easily install, the overwhelming majority all be use ordinary optical fingerprint, its shortcoming is
Deficiency the most attractive in appearance but also fingerprint are easy to be forged (just can easily be verified as glued the fingerprint inhaling typing person by adhesive tape).
The fingerprint identification module 2 of this programme uses the FPC1020+ biological fingerprint identification module of FINGERPRINTS company of Sweden, with China
Using same money fingerprint identification module for MATE 7, MATE 8 mobile phone, safety is attractive in appearance, and its input and indication panel include fingerprint
Cog region 13 and signal lamp district 14.The most attractive in appearance in order to allow fingerprint identification module 2 both install, also ensure that and open the door to user
During record fingerprint, maximum is convenient and swift, and input and indication panel use and include ground floor panel and the Double-layer acrylic of second layer base
Plate structure (not shown), the first level thickness of slab 1mm, the correspondence position acting primarily as protective effect fingerprint identification area 13 has
Fingerprint identification hole is fitted facilitating finger;Second layer base while playing a supportive role at fingerprint identification hole to the right 5mm opening,
To allow the sensing line of fingerprint identification module 2 pass through, then DSP control chip AB is adhesive on the back side of second layer base.
Fingerprint identification module 2 is initially in sleep state, and each user touches fingerprint identification area 13 all can wake up fingerprint identification module up
2 and send an IRQ (i.e. interrupt requests) pulse to main control chip 1, after main control chip 1 records the pulse number in 4 seconds
Sending dormancy instruction at once allows fingerprint identification module 2 again sleep, if pulse number is 1, enters network configuration pattern, as
Really pulse number is 2 entrance fingerprint management patterns, if pulse number is 3, before emptying, network parameter forces distribution again.
In other words, if user touches fingerprint identification area 13 once in 4 seconds, enter network configuration pattern, touch twice and then enter fingerprint
Management mode, before then emptying for three times, network parameter forces distribution again.This network configuration pattern, fingerprint management pattern and
Emptying the inherent function that parameter is all this fingerprint identification module 2, the innovative point of this programme is being contacted with by IRQ pulse
Come, Gu no longer these 3 kinds of patterns are described in detail.
Electromechanical locks 3 is arranged on the cabinet door of Intelligent key box body 12, is used for opening or closing cabinet door.Wifi module 4 is used for
Receive from the encryption data of main control chip 1 and send it to distribution professional server 6.The control of intelligent key management box system
Panel processed is arranged on the front of cabinet door, including Quick Response Code scanning area 15, input and indication panel, numerical ciphers input area 16,
Door handle 17 and mechanical key jack 18.Fingerprint identification area 13 is positioned at above door handle 17 7-12cm (in view of different people
Hand size is not quite similar) place, preferably 10cm, during use, as long as general forehand user touches fingerprint identification area 13 with forefinger,
To be verified sent by signal after its hands be placed exactly in most convenient and turn on the position of door handle 17, identifying opens the door accomplish without any letup the most square
Just, door opening action is at utmost facilitated.
Intelligent key management box system use 7-12V external dc power 10 and 6 joint AAA battery 11 supply power with double circuit, and with electricity
Machine lock power supply 19 phase is independent, and i.e. under intelligence system powering-off state, electromechanical locks 3 still can be used.6 joint AAA batteries 11 are arranged on
In intelligence system battery case 20, switch 9 is selected to carry out electricity by stirring the powering mode being arranged on intelligence system battery case 20
Source switches.It addition, intelligence system battery case 20 designs by integrating with external dc power 10 plug, the two is permissible
One step directly replaces to ups power module.
As shown in Figure 3-4, key status detection matrix 5 is arranged in Intelligent key box body 12, and it includes multiple key position,
Forming the key status detection matrix of 15 × 7, each key position includes key hole 21 and position label 22, and each
The back side of key position is configured with 1 1N4148 switching diode (a kind of existing miniature high-speed switching diode).Key hole
21 use DC-022B D/C power socket, firmly install with screw thread, and every is mounted with relative with described position label 22 on the key
The key number plate 23 answered, it is possible to use key check mark is inserted by family easily according to corresponding key number plate 23.Reading case
During the state of interior key, switching diode coordinates with supply socket and sends the state of switching diode to master control core by holding wire
Sheet 1, thus the use state of key in drawing current box.Those skilled in the art understand that this programme, Fig. 6 give key for convenience
The front view of spoon jack, Fig. 7 is the side view of DC-022B D/C power socket, owing to this structure itself is not improved by this programme,
Its structure is told about the most in detail at this.
As it is shown in figure 5, distribution professional server 6 is associated with wechat server cluster, user is realized by wechat public platform
Information mutual communication with distribution professional server 6.
Operation principle and the using method of this intelligent key management box system are as follows:
First every key is mixed key number plate 23, numbering and title typing by switching station or the distribution box title of its correspondence to it
The data base of distribution professional server 6, simultaneously give have key use authority personnel's typing fingerprint, and associate fingerprint ID and its
Wechat OPENID (the digital identity identification framework of a kind of customer-centric in wechat, it has open, dispersibility).
Under battery-powered operation pattern, intelligent key management box system is in order at utmost economize on electricity, and main control chip 1 is (real at this
Executing and using model in example is ATMega2560) it is constantly in sleep state in Power Down mode and closes except referring to identify
Other all modules beyond stricture of vagina module 2, until having detected that user's finger touches fingerprint identification area 13, fingerprint identification module 2 is i.e.
Wake up quarter and send an IRQ pulse to main control chip 1 and waken up up;Main control chip 1 is waken up backward fingerprint identification module
2 send checking fingerprint order, if not by then returning to sleep pattern, then record its fingerprint ID as user passes through checking and drive
The motor of electromechanical locks 3 is unblanked, and reads now key status detection matrix 5 simultaneously and draws the state of the front all keys that open the door, afterwards
Go successively to sleep state.Subscriber Application Barring Lock main control chip 1 behind the door is again interrupted and wakes up up, now again reads off key status detection square
Battle array 5 draws the state closing the most all keys, and startup RTC clock module 7 reads the time simultaneously, restart WIFI module 4 to
Distribution professional server 6 transmits user fingerprints ID, the encryption of twice key status detection matrix condition before and after operating time, enabling
Data, if transmitting unsuccessfully, are stored into EEPROM storage chip 8 and treat that next time retransmits by data.Last main control chip 1 is closed
The modules such as RTC clock module 7, WIFI module 3 also send SLEEP instruction to fingerprint identification module 2, and then main control chip 1 is certainly
Oneself enters sleep state, and one time entire flow terminates.
Hereafter, each user open the door borrow go back key after equipment all the concrete operations of key status in case and user to be passed to distribution special
Industry server 6, other users are paying close attention to after wechat public number just it can be seen that all key current states, finally borrow also people timely
Between, the Record of Borrowing record of oneself.Meanwhile, user can also send overdue notice to key as antecessor by public number,
Or mark certain key and receive the prompting that public number sends when it is returned.Have the management personnel of certain authority it can also be seen that
The Record of Borrowing record of all users.
It addition, distribution professional server 6 phase can be asked by the visit device that wechat is built-in when user clicks on public number function menu
The web page answered, can directly guide it to carry out the OAuth2.0 (0Auth1.0 mourned in silence when this page needs to judge user right
Next version of agreement, the internet standard that the most open platform such as Baidu's open platform, Tengxun's open platform is currently used
Agreement), one of this advantage being also based on wechat public platform, i.e. input username and password without user and just may determine that its body
Part is to open different System Privileges and function to it.
